在文件交换上有一个提交可以执行此操作:

(Block) tri-diagonal matrices.

您为该函数提供了三个3D阵列,3D阵列的每一层代表一个主要,次要或超对角的块. (这意味着块必须具有相同的大小.)结果将是一个稀疏矩阵,因此它在内存方面应该是相当有效的.

一个示例用法是:

As = bsxfun(@times,ones(3),permute(1:3,[3,1,2]));

Bs = bsxfun(@times,ones(3),permute(10:11,[3,1,2]));

M = blktridiag(As, zeros(size(Bs)), Bs);

满(M)给你的地方:

1 1 1 10 10 10 0 0 0

1 1 1 10 10 10 0 0 0

1 1 1 10 10 10 0 0 0

0 0 0 2 2 2 11 11 11

0 0 0 2 2 2 11 11 11

0 0 0 2 2 2 11 11 11

0 0 0 0 0 0 3 3 3

0 0 0 0 0 0 3 3 3

0 0 0 0 0 0 3 3 3

matlab定义对角块矩阵,Matlab中的扩展块对角矩阵相关推荐

  1. matlab定义未知大小矩阵,MATLAB中未知长度的矩阵?

    青春有我 在尝试节省空间时考虑性能的另一种方法是大批量预分配内存,根据需要添加更多批次.如果您必须在不知道预先确定的数量的情况下添加大量项目,这非常适合.BLOCK_SIZE = 2000;      ...

  2. matlab 矩阵 矢量场,Matlab将矢量转换为矩阵(Matlab turning vectors into a matrix)

    Matlab将矢量转换为矩阵(Matlab turning vectors into a matrix) 我不确切地知道如何用这个问题来表达,但我有3个列向量,我试图将它们变成矩阵,这样矩阵基本上看起 ...

  3. 如何用matlab编写分段函数_请教各位怎样用matlab定义一个分段函数MATLAB分段函数...

    请教各位怎样用matlab定义一个分段函数 MATLAB分段函数 www.zhiqu.org     时间: 2020-12-08 matlab提供了了两种定义分段函数的方法: 常规方法:使用if.. ...

  4. linux 块编辑,vim中的可视块编辑

    我已经参考这个 post在vim中使用块编辑.但是当我在块选择后键入I或c时,vim进入正常编辑模式,就像我按下了i一样.我还发现,当选择块时,我可以使用x键删除块中的字符. 在按I之前: 按I后: ...

  5. linux nand 坏块_Nand Flash 中的坏块(Bad Block)

    Nand Flash 中,一个块中含有 1 个或多个位是坏的,就称为其为坏块 Bad Block. 坏块的稳定性是无法保证的,也就是说,不能保证你写入的数据是对的,或者写入对了,读 出来也不一定对的. ...

  6. java类中的static块_java类中static代码块的执行次数

    java类中 static静态代码块的执行次数 1.在类加载的init阶段,类的类构造器中会收集所有的static块和字段并执行,static块只执行一次,由JVM保证其只执行一次. 2.直接看示例 ...

  7. matlab定义函数多输入,matlab .m文件中定义多个函数

    matlab帮助系统中的说明: Functions The main difference between a script and a function is thata function acce ...

  8. matlab定义字母常数,在matlab中,如何定义函数式子中的未知常数。

    新建一个.m文件,第一行输入下面的格式function [y,m] = abc(x)其中... 定义未知数:syms xx是变量 .syms是定义符号变量.补充:syms是... 这不是解方程,这是曲 ...

  9. matlab 范德蒙德矩阵,Matlab中fft与fwelch有什么区别?如何用fft求功率谱?

    讲这个话题,就要先搞清楚频谱.功率谱的概念,可参考我的另一篇文章 做信号处理的朋友应该都会fft比较熟悉,就是求傅里叶变换.我在这里也不再去讲这个函数了,但需要注意的一点:实信号的频谱关于0频对称,是 ...

  10. matlab 定义张量,如何使用MATLAB作张量运算

    2012年第05期 吉林省教育学院学报 No.05,2012 第28卷JOURNAL OF EDUCATIONAL INSTITUTE OF JILIN PROVINCE Vol .28(总293期) ...

最新文章

  1. vb mysql 查询_vb中用sql语句查询数据库
  2. 在Java中有类似.NET的NotImplementedException吗?
  3. 关于单元测试脚手架的几点思考
  4. 迅雷Chrome插件引发的Uncaught ReferenceError: xl_chrome_menu is not defined JS报错
  5. “如果产品经理躺平接受需求,那程序员免不了想打一架”
  6. 怎样改变java编码风格_如何说服同事修改些代码的风格(JAVA的)。。求指引
  7. 年末盘点,2021年最值得推荐的10个提高开发效率工具,程序员必备
  8. 计算机快捷指令ip,IP小技巧之如何使用DOS命令行快速修改电脑IP地址?
  9. 集成googlepay,出现Service not registered
  10. (statistic)你所不知道的P值--对统计学的批判
  11. 长江口陆地、岛屿变迁与沙地人迁徙史.doc
  12. RNA m6A修饰问题汇总
  13. 3D立体相册 html+css
  14. 我为何不介意女朋友不是处女?
  15. 星戈瑞收藏Sulfo-CY7 amine/NHS ester/maleimide小鼠活体成像染料标记反应
  16. 基于深度学习的推荐系统:综述与新视角
  17. SaaS平台及资源预约系统
  18. 算法3-加减号得数方法数
  19. php 截取日期的年月,PHP截取日期
  20. Spark SQL 工作流程源码解析(四)optimization 阶段(基于 Spark 3.3.0)

热门文章

  1. qt界面中Pushbutton添加图片的三种显示效果
  2. python滑稽脸_使用python的turtle绘画滑稽脸实例
  3. 英语在计算机上的应用研究,计算机在英语教学中的应用
  4. 我的世界服务器怎么无限附魔,我的世界无限附魔书指令
  5. matlab中log和复数表示,matlab复数表示
  6. (8.1)基于牛顿-欧拉公式的动力学方程
  7. 淘宝新规:售假者严重违规须缴纳100%保证金
  8. 最快年底出台 上海二手车车牌启动竞拍模式
  9. 方向导数与梯度——学习笔记
  10. 学3D建模需要什么基础?